What Is the Opportunity?

The Senior Software Engineer (Technical Lead) for Bond & Specialty Insurance (BSI) will help embed GenAI technologies and practices into our engineering ecosystem—enhancing productivity, accelerating innovation, and empowering engineers to leverage AI responsibly and effectively in daily workflows.

This technical leader will:
• Elevate engineering maturity by championing modern software delivery patterns, automation, and best-in-class resiliency practices.
• Enable domain-aligned teams to operate with greater autonomy and velocity through modular, API-driven, and decoupled solutions.
• Drive GenAI adoption and skill-building across our engineering community, equipping teams to innovate faster and make data-driven decisions.

Ultimately, this investment helps to ensure our teams can deliver adaptable, intelligent, and efficient technology capabilities that directly support business growth, speed to market, and long-term operational resilience.

What Will Our Ideal Candidate Have?

  • 5+ years of professional software engineering experience, with at least 1 year shipping production systems built on LLMs or AI agents (not prototypes or demos).
  • Technical Stack: GitHub, Python, NET/C#, Angular, AWS, OCF, Mongo, DocumentDB, SQL Server 
  • Demonstrated experience with modern agent frameworks (e.g., Claude Agent SDK, LangGraph, AgentCore or similar) and LLM APIs (Anthropic, OpenAI, etc.).
  • Proficiency with core agent engineering concepts: tool use, retrieval, multi-step workflows, evaluation, and observability.
  • Strong software fundamentals — distributed systems, API design, testing, CI/CD — applied to AI-augmented systems.
  • Experience defining and driving the technical direction of a workstream or product area, not just executing assigned tasks.
  • Track record of identifying opportunities and influencing engineering or product strategy through technical insight.
  • Adept at making decisions that involve a significant number of factors with broad implications.
  • Communication - Strong communicator who possesses the ability to describe technology concepts in ways the business can understand, document initiatives in a concise and clear manner, collaborate effectively with teammates and others regardless of role, quickly extract core issues from discussions and meetings, give and receive constructive feedback, offer help when asked, and ensure everyone has a chance to share their thoughts and are heard; an attentive and empathetic listener.
  • Leadership - Advanced leadership skills with the ability to take action even when there is no clear owner, inspire and motivate others, and be effective at influencing team members

What Is in It for You?

  • Health Insurance: Employees and their eligible family members – including spouses, domestic partners, and children – are eligible for coverage from the first day of employment.
  • Retirement: Travelers matches your 401(k) contributions dollar-for-dollar up to your first 5% of eligible pay, subject to an annual maximum. If you have student loan debt, you can enroll in the Paying it Forward Savings Program. When you make a payment toward your student loan, Travelers will make an annual contribution into your 401(k) account. You are also eligible for a Pension Plan that is 100% funded by Travelers.
  • Paid Time Off: Start your career at Travelers with a minimum of 20 days Paid Time Off annually, plus nine paid company Holidays.
  • Wellness Program: The Travelers wellness program is comprised of tools, discounts and resources that empower you to achieve your wellness goals and caregiving needs. In addition, our mental health program provides access to free professional counseling services, health coaching and other resources to support your daily life needs.
  • Volunteer Encouragement: We have a deep commitment to the communities we serve and encourage our employees to get involved. Travelers has a Matching Gift and Volunteer Rewards program that enables you to give back to the charity of your choice.
